Connecting Kunming and Yuxi, the Ku-Yu Railroad, which is the first local railroad built at local expenses in China, has become a new economic main line in Middle Yunan. Train No. K441 sets off Yuxi at 8:27 am, and arrives at Kunming at 10:44 am. Train No. K442 sets off Kunming at 5:52 pm and arrives at Yuxi at 7:58 pm. The price for the ticket is 17 yuan.

The highway network is Yuxi is composed of three levels of highways. The National Highways, Kunming -Yuxi Superhighway and Yuxi-Yuanjiang Superhighway, are arterial lines. The highways starting from Yuxi to all the counties, which all exceed second class are frameworks. And the roads leading to all the villages are branch lines.

Passenger Transportation Center: Located in the Shanhu Road Overpass, this station has bus lines to Kunming and other places in the Province. The air condition middle-sized bus costs 18.5 yuan per person. Iveco bus costs 20 yuan per person. Santana costs 40 yuan per person. Telephone: 0877-2022807.

West Bus Station: Located in the Qixing Street, the station has bus lines to Chengjiang, Jiangchuan, Yuanjiang, and other places inside the city. However, there are no bus lines to places out Yuxi. Telephone: 0877-2026592.

There are buses and taxis to the scenic spots in Yuxi. It is very convenient for the tourists.

Taxi

The brands of taxis in Yuxi are Xiali and Santana. If you travel in the downtown area, the taxi fee is not counted according to the meter but charged 5 yuan without exception.

Bus

The bus lines in the city are also very convenient. The buses are self-service and cost 0.5 yuan per person.
